Default Iminant Danger! Help!

I came home tonight to find my perculas ripping apart my ritteri anemone! I've seen them rip off a tentacle or two before, but today they tore into it's body and it's mouth is gaping open. I don't think it will recover. Strings of zoo. etc. are coming out of the holes and it's mouth. My water is cloudy and I'm wondering if I should take it out now to save a crash. I have a QT, but nowhere near enough light for it. What should I do? I have to work 12 hours a day, so I have to do something tonight! Rich.
